Herbert Lee Slayden, Jr. (Herby/Herb) 86 of Cumming, Georgia died after a brief illness on Saturday, November 8, 2025. Herby was born in Lyons, Georgia on November 29, 1938, to the late Herbert Lee and Marion Lilliott Slayden. Along with his parents he is predeceased by his son, Herbert Lee Slayden III, his brother and sister-in-law, Kay and Nancy Slayden, and his mother-in- law Margaret Triplett.
Herby attended Marvin Yancey School in Lyons, Georgia, and in 1947 the family moved to Columbus where Herby grew up. He attended Tillinghurst Elementary and Columbus Junior High School. He graduated from Jordan Vocational High School in 1956 and was an outstanding basketball player. Following graduation, he played basketball at Auburn University and LaGrange College.
He had a successful career working for GE and The Foxboro Company as a Process Control Engineer and later opened his own computer company, Meta Tech, writing software programs for police departments and libraries throughout the southeast. Herby had a wonderful sense of humor and was an excellent storyteller. He enjoyed all sports, riding motorcycles and collecting cars. He loved his family and never forgot his South Georgia roots and the Red Dirt Road. Through the years he and Carolyn had beloved pets that gave them many hours of pleasure.
